In today’s competitive real‑estate market, first impressions can be the difference between a closed deal and a lost opportunity. Prospective buyers and renters often begin their journey online, and the speed, accuracy, and personalization of the initial interaction can set the tone for the entire transaction. A well‑designed showing request bot not only captures leads but also guides potential clients through property tours, answer FAQs, and schedules appointments—all without a human agent being on standby 24/7. By integrating AI-driven conversations into your website, you can keep engagement high, reduce response times, and free up your sales team to focus on closing deals rather than answering repetitive questions. Below, we’ve compiled five of the best showing‑request bots that real‑estate agencies can implement right now. These solutions range from fully custom no‑code platforms to industry‑standard chat‑support tools, ensuring that whether you’re a boutique agency or a large brokerage, there’s a bot that fits your workflow, budget, and brand identity.

Drift is a conversational marketing platform that has evolved into a comprehensive chatbot solution for sales and customer engagement. Originally designed to facilitate real‑time messaging between buyers and sales teams, Drift now offers AI‑powered chatbots that can qualify leads, book meetings, and answer common questions. Its conversational AI uses natural language understanding to interpret user intent, routing inquiries to the appropriate human agent or internal knowledge base when needed. Drift’s integration ecosystem is extensive, supporting Salesforce, HubSpot, Zendesk, and many other CRMs, enabling seamless handoff of qualified leads to sales pipelines. The platform also features a visual bot builder that allows users to map conversation flows without coding. Drift’s analytics dashboard provides insights into conversation volume, conversion rates, and agent performance, helping agencies optimize engagement strategies.

Intercom is a customer messaging platform that blends chatbots, live chat, and automated messaging into a unified interface. It offers a bot builder that lets users create automated responses to common inquiries, schedule follow‑ups, and trigger email sequences. Intercom’s AI assistant can understand user intent and route conversations to human agents or support articles when appropriate. The platform’s powerful segmentation tools enable targeted messaging based on user behavior, demographics, and engagement history. Intercom also provides a robust API and integrations with popular CRMs, marketing automation tools, and e‑commerce platforms, ensuring that data flows smoothly across systems.

Zendesk Chat (formerly Zopim) is a live‑chat solution that integrates seamlessly with the Zendesk support suite. It offers a bot component called Chatbot Builder, enabling the creation of automated responses, lead qualification, and appointment scheduling. The platform supports real‑time messaging, visitor tracking, and contextual data collection, which can feed into customer service tickets or sales pipelines. Zendesk Chat’s bot framework uses simple rule‑based logic and can be extended with custom code via the Zendesk API. The solution is particularly strong in environments where Zendesk is already the primary support platform, allowing for unified ticketing, chat, and bot interactions.

LiveChat is a popular live‑chat software that offers a simple chatbot feature for automating routine inquiries and routing conversations. Its bot can be configured to answer FAQs, collect contact details, and forward leads to sales agents. LiveChat provides a clean, user‑friendly interface for managing chats, and its API allows integration with CRMs, help desks, and marketing automation tools. The platform also offers real‑time visitor monitoring, which can trigger bots based on user behavior. LiveChat’s pricing is tiered based on the number of chat agents and features, making it accessible for small to medium‑sized real‑estate agencies.
